Historically, critics viewed popular culture as a mirror. From Aristotle’s catharsis to Shakespeare’s “stage” of the world, art and entertainment were seen as imitations of life—lower-case, secondary realities that commented on a primary, “real” world. This model assumed a stable boundary between the fictional and the factual.
